The Cretan plateau of Lassithi is one the most important tourist attraction of the island and a great place for a full day excursion.
Near the settlement of Agios Georgios there is an ethnographic park.
There are several pavilions in the park.
In one pavilion you will learn about the history of the Lassithi plateau ...
... in the other you will see handmade products.
In the next pavilion you will see how people worked on the loom ...
... and next door there is a pottery workshop where a real master works.
And of course, all products are on sale.
